structural foam moldingPlastic and nitrogen gas are injected into a closed cavity mold.The part is cooled to create the exact shape of the mold.The combined use of these materials creates a cellular core that forms a solid skin. These pallets have high strength to weight ratio, reduced deflection, accurate tolerances, are cleanable, and have superior static load capacity for racking, distribution, stacking, and ASRS equipment. single or twin sheet thermoforming(HMWPE)In single sheet thermoforming, a sheet of plastic is heated and then drawn by vacuum over a mold. In twin sheet thermoforming, two sheets of plastic are heated and drawn by vacuum over separate molds and then fused together through pressure to form a structural double walled part. Pallets made by thermoforming are lightweight, cleanable, have flex memory and are impact resistant.Applications include distribution, textile, food, auto assembly and work-in-process applications. injection moldingPlastic is injected, under pressure, into a closed cavity mold, then the material is cooled to ensure that it maintains the exact shape of the mold.This process produces a solid wall, solid core part. Injection molded pallets are lightweight and cleanable, have accurate tolerances, superior static load capacity, and superior impact resistance with reduced deflection. Applications include racking, distribution, ASRS equipment, work-in-process and cold storage. |
In the last few decades, progressive industries and world-class companies have converted from wood pallets to plastic pallets for their work-in-process, storage and distribution applications.They quickly recognized the economic, ergonomic and environmental benefits that plastic pallets offer: economic:
In a closed loop system, plastic pallets make a tremendous number of trips before being recycled. On a cost per trip basis, plastic pallets represent great savings over wood pallets. Plastic pallets rapidly realize their initial investment and continue to perform during the course of their service life. ergonomic:Plastic pallets provide a safe and comfortable handling solution, which improves workplace safety. They are dimensionally stable, consistent in weight and non-porous. In some cases, they are lighter than wood and their smooth and contoured construction is free of nails, splinters and rust. environmental:
Using plastic preserves natural resources, while reducing waste. Wood pallets consume precious natural resources, up to 10 million trees are cut each year to produce wood pallets.When retired from service, wood pallets are sent to landfills.Plastic pallets offer a much longer life and can be recycled into other useful products at the end of their service life. |
